The wall behind the Presidential Ballroom's primary table is reinforced with six feet of concrete and steel, installed originally following World War I I for the safety of seated government officials. Another interesting historic tidbit, an automobile lift was constructed that elevated F D R's private car to the second floor ballroom

Located 500 yards from the hotel, the Brickskeller Dining House holds the Guinness World Record for offering the most commercially available varieties of beer in the world. The Brickskeller is famous for introducing new beers to the public since it opened in 1957
